Good value/upgrade over OEM speakers
Have had 2 sets of these installed for about 10 days now. Big improvement over the paper cone OEM speakers that came with my vehicle. Tweeters are directional a few degrees in all directions with included install brackets/rings. Sounds seems well balanced for this price point and product seems decently made. Due to this products efficiency rating of 92dB (@ 1 Watt/1 Meter), high volume is easily acheived using just the built-in amps in my head unit with out distortion. Packaging: typical speaker package, all the needed hardware and accessories included to complete the install. Grills, crossover, two types of tweeter mounts (flush or surface), pre-installed wire (18 gauge wire), brackets, screws, etc. Crossover: is compact, pre-wired, and pre-labeled for mid and high drivers, comes with double stick tape/foam to mount to most surfaces. I have the crossovers stuck to the inside wall of my front and rear doors with no power window clearance issues. Just watch what direction you run your wires inside to door to prevent snags or hang ups on the window. Once I got my wires positioned to run to the mid-bass and tweeter and tested it by lowering the power windows I used tape to hold the wires and secure it in place. Mid-bass driver: sturdy construction optional grills, not much more to say about it. Tweeter: two install options, mounting ring a little tricky to snap in place, but once you get one done it's easy to duplicate the process to the others. Try not to press on the center of the tweeter grill when taking the mount rings on or off, could dent in. I personally didn't dent in the grill, and applied a reasonable amount of force with my thumbs, but in retrospect I should have pressed more to the edges. Tweeters can be pointed in any direction a few degrees if needed for accuracy. Opinions based on 24 years of do-it-yourself car electronics installation experience and 8 years of home audio/video professional sales experience. I've always had aftermarket speakers/head units in my cars/trucks - I recommend this product for quick upgrade. Installed in: 2008 Chevrolet Silverado 2500HD, front and rear doors Mid-mass installed in factory door positions (using Scosche SAGMHR634B) Tweeter installed flush in door panel, cut-out made with hole saw drill attachment powered by Pioneer AVIC-F900BT - 50w x 4 max

Ugh.. I tried.
Purchased these to replace my factory front door speakers in 04 MINI Cooper S. One of my stock tweeters was crackling so I bought a new set of fronts. I'll be honest here.. I was a car audio/video/security specialist for almost 10 years. I have installed it all from JL and Hertz to Power Accoustic and Boss. Being that I had never hear of this brand before I decided to give them a try. I bought all new sound deadening and new mounting adaptors for the front doors so the fit was nice and the panels didn't vibrate. The woofers mount seamlessly and the tweeters are small enough to fit in the factory location with minor modification to the stock mount. The one thing that concerned me was the crossover. It was so tiny and flimsy that when I took it out of the plastic it was wrapped in the cover came off. This was fortuitous in that it revealed cheap components and poor quality wire. The wiring had black marks (oxidation) on it which in this industry is bad. Oxygen free copper should be used for this and I would expect at least a 12dB crossover. This appeared to be only 6dB. I proceeded to finish the install since there are glorious reviews and who knows.. They may be great. These seriously do not live up to the glowing reviews I read on here. The tweeter is crossed over way too high and only produces tinny noises which seem to be 10kHz or above and the woofer really doesn't have any lower frequency response to speak of. My factory 5ohm paper cone speakers sounded better. I double checked my wiring for phase and tried adjusting the stereo but it just sounds bad. In summary... Don't waste your time. Spend $10-20 more for a better set. Heck I'm returning mine and going to order Alpine Type-E components for about the same price. At least I know they will be quality.

These are.....well....average.....
I wish I could lavish praise here as others have done but I just can't get there. You are pretty much getting what you paid for here. The first pro here is the these speakers sound reasonably good, that is in my opinion about the measure of them, they sound good not great. Unlike other reviewers I found the base performance for a 6x9 at about average. I tried them in door panels and an mdf box running off a head unit amp and separate 105w/channel Focal amp which has a really clean curve. The bass is okay as are the highs. Further I think the mids are on the weak side. The second pro is pretty obvious - the price. I good paid more than this for an average pair of 6x9s in the 1980s. Economies of scale whatever - its a price for even average speakers. The first con is build quality. The tweeter/"mid" mount on one of the speakers was glued a considerable amount off-level to the remainder of the speaker chassis. I had one level and one out of level, I am guessing the level version is the correct approach. The second con may just be a personal problem, but why is there not a cutout template included in the box? It is so easy and low cost to provide one and on the opposite side an almost necessity if you need one and do not have it. As it was I rummaged through my shop and found an old blown 6x9 and stripped the trim ring off of it and it was close enough to work. Conclusion: After considering the build quality and listening to what they had to offer I did go ahead and install them in the door panels in an old Dodge D150 I have. The reason being is that if you have a noisy vehicle(which my truck is) higher fidelity speakers offer very limited returns. My thoughts are this is a well-priced average performing speaker that would be great in a vehicle with a high noise floor. If you are looking for truly musical speakers, I think you gotta invest a some more money.
